Abstract
The University of Rochester’s Laboratory for Laser Energetics (LLE) and Institute of Optics provide comprehensive educational opportunities in lasers and optics that support research in inertial confinement fusion (ICF). Undergraduate and graduate students take courses in optical system design, coatings, and ultrafast and petawatt laser systems and pursue ICF-relevant research topics such as bandwidth enhancement of high-average power lasers, cryogenic cooling of diode-pumped materials, and UV photodiode-based characterization of OMEGA 60 pulses. Supporting future workforce needs, LLE has pioneered high-school programs that 1) invite students to participate in ICF-related research and 2) introduce ICF science to students from underrepresented minorities.
